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> Rozwijane menu
-Wieviór-
post
Post #1





Goście







Oto kod:
[php:1:afa81d8d1c]
<form method="POST" action="">
<p><select size="1" name="obrazek"><select>
<? mysql_connect ("localhost", "xxx", "xxx") or
die ("Nie można nawiązać połączenia z mySQL");
mysql_select_db ("news") or
die ("Nie można znaleść bazy");

if ($_GET[id]>0)
{
$wynik = mysql_query ("SELECT * FROM images ORDER BY id") or die(mysql_error());
?>
</select>
<table border="0" cellpadding="0" cellspacing="0" width="60%">
<?
while ($rekord = mysql_fetch_array ($wynik))
{
echo '<option value="'.$rekord[sciezka].'">'.$rekord[nazwa].'</option>';
}
}
?>
</select><input type="submit" value="Submit">
</form>
[/php:1:afa81d8d1c]

I to menu rozwijalne jest puste... tak jakby nie bylo rekordów w tabeli Images
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
Foxx
post
Post #2





Grupa: Zarejestrowani
Postów: 896
Pomógł: 76
Dołączył: 15.11.2003
Skąd: Sosnowiec/Kraków

Ostrzeżenie: (0%)
-----


[php:1:246ff5bd44]<?php
<form method="POST" action="">
<p><select size="1" name="obrazek">
<? mysql_connect ("localhost", "", "") or
die ("Nie można nawiązać połączenia z mySQL");
mysql_select_db ("test") or
die ("Nie można znaleść bazy");

if ($_GET[id]>0)
{
$wynik = mysql_query ("SELECT * FROM tabela ORDER BY id") or die(mysql_error());
while ($rekord = mysql_fetch_array ($wynik))
{
?><option value="<?=$rekord['sciezka']?>"><?=$rekord['nazwa']?></option><?
}
}
?>
</select>
<input type="submit" value="Submit">
</form>
?>[/php:1:246ff5bd44]
Poczytaj o SELECT - składnia jest taka:
<SELECT>
<OPTION> a
<OPTION> b
</SELECT>

PS - zmieniłem dane bazy danych, weź to pod uwagę (IMG:http://forum.php.pl/style_emoticons/default/smile.gif)
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 27.12.2025 - 22:30